Hey everyone,

 

I am pretty well versed in Skyrim modding and I've learned over the years how to fix a myriad of CTDS and other glitches.... However something new has been happening with my Oldrim.... which never occured in SSE from what I remember.... Before I start I'd like everyone to know that I have over 550 mods running on my game, many of which have been merged into multiple ESPs to bypass the hard coded 255 limit.... I currently am at 249/255 ESPs too and I dont really lag ingame.... I also use Loot and Wyrebash too. However recently when I installed a mod... I went to try to load my game and it said mods where uninstalled and I knew that was odd as I didnt uninstall anything... so I go to load it and it CTD.... I then tried to make a new game and it loaded like normal however it gave me the default Bethesda intro... Which was strange as I run Alternate start.... I also noticed that only a fraction of mods seemed to be working on the cart ride down to the block. So I disabled that mod and I reloaded skyrim and it worked perfectly and everything was fine and when I went to make a new character it put me in the alternate start cell. I then decided that it could simply be a bad mod or it conflicted with my load order and so I ignored it then I went to install another mod... and the same result happened.... and I did the same and it fixed then I proceeded to try a third time and similiar results... With 3 different mods all repeating the results I can assume its not a single confliction or error that causes this issue... Is there a secret hidden limit to how many mods one can run even if you merge mods together? Or could it be the product of an outdated mod or something... oh how would one use the ghost feature? And would mods that simply change textures count towards that 580 limit?

 

Edit: Yea I think your right on point.... My active mod list is exactly 581 and it works... and it seems anything else over that, results in that error... Is ghosting easy and would it be possible for merged ESPs and mods or?

Well, assuming you've got Wrye Bash downloaded and running, in the main window right-click where it says "file" at the top - under where you see the "Installer", "Mods", etc. tabs. Then click "Auto-Ghost" and give it a second to work.
